This is good news. Our animals are plagued by tick fever, every worm imaginable and a host of illnesses so unless a healthy animal is actually taken care of by belonging to a responsible owner he won't stay healthy for long. The strays are out there scavenging for food and fighting with raccoons and not necessarily getting their vaccinations etc.

I agree that euthanizing healthy animals is a shame, but letting an animal struggle, get ill, starve and suffer while enjoying the "freedom" of the streets and beaches really isn't a responsible thing for us to do as a community.

Please post the cost per shot or a suggested amount of donation for folks to make that will help towards the program. A pledge system would be sustainable, say $5 per month per donor (for example) so that you can guarantee that in the future the town won't be put in the position again of having to use poison because the donation well has run dry.
